The welder is required to watch the ____________ preheat.

The requirement for the welder to watch the entire preheat phase is crucial in thermite welding because the entire process involves heating the metal components to a temperature that allows for optimal bonding. Properly monitoring the entire preheating ensures that the metal reaches the appropriate temperature uniformly, which is vital for achieving a strong weld. Any areas that are not sufficiently preheated may lead to weaknesses in the weld joint, resulting in potential failures.

By attending to the entire preheat process, the welder ensures that both pieces of metal achieve the necessary temperature for effective fusion during the welding operation. This oversight plays a significant role in the overall quality and durability of the weld. Understanding this critical aspect helps welders maintain standards and produce reliable, high-quality welds.
